Desmond Howard is fully invested in Louisville Cardinals quarterback Lincoln Kienholz, praising his dual-threat abilities and athleticism. After transferring from Ohio State, Kienholz became the starting QB for the Cardinals and has excelled, averaging 5.5 yards per carry and scoring three rushing touchdowns. Howard, speaking on ESPN College GameDay, highlighted Kienholz's running skills, ability to read blocking, and scoring capability.
With the No. 23 Cardinals facing the No. 16 SMU Mustangs, Kienholz's performance will be crucial, as he must lead the team's offense with strong passing and rushing plays.
